mi era successa una cosa simile facendo dei test di ripristino di raid software ed in effetti a seconda del disco che smontavo il sistema partiva o meno, alla fine ho fatto cosė utilizzando grub...
1) ho copiato MBR del disco 1 sul disco 2;
2) ho modificato il file menu.lst inserendo il comando
fallback=1 e copiato la riga di lancio presente modificando solo la voce root(hd0,0) in root(hd1,0)
questo dovrebbe assicurarmi che se il primo disco non va dopo un certo lasso di tempo prefissato (
timeout=5 ... di norma ) si tenta il boot dal secondo disco ... che č uguale al primo.
magari prima fai delle prove su una macchina virtuale .....
